GOD'S CHARIOTS (MASHUP) by KSIAN BOKTET published on 2025-03-14T11:47:51Z a mashup of Oklou - God's Chariots/Duran Duran Duran - Untitled (2017)/Terminal 11 - Hoover Assault of Precinct 11 Genre Pop